I expect that this item is a bit dated, but try it as a starting point in the
citation indices.

Author:    International Agency for Research on Cancer (IARC)
Title:     IARC Monographs on the evaluation of carcinogenic risks to humans.
Subtitle:  Chlorinated drinking-water; chlorination by-products;
           some other halogenated compounds; cobalt and cobalt compounds.
Series nr: 52
Published: Lyon 1991.
ISBN:      9283212525


Have you checked the Merck Index?
